- [ ] Step 7: Archive cold storage buckets (Glacierline tier). Confirm both ceremony witnesses are present, verify bucket manifests match the Oxbow ledger, then seal the archive key shares. Plugin authors may observe but not handle shares. Once sealed, the archive index itself is encrypted and can only be reopened with the passphrase below.

vault phrase of badup-hahig = tamael-aldael-kelmir-istael-fenok-istwyn-tamius-jorath-oliion

## Configuration

GridForge streams spreadsheet exports row by row to keep memory flat, even on million-row sheets. Plugin authors should respect the `GF_CHUNK_ROWS` setting (default 5000) rather than buffering entire sheets. Exports larger than the chunk limit are signed by the export service, which requires a credential set on this line:

secret setting of yajog-taguf: ARCHIVE_KEY3=051

Subject: On-call intro — driver-assignment heuristic

Hi, and welcome to the Pellfort dispatch rotation. The assignment heuristic weighs driver proximity, shift remaining, and vehicle class; when it misfires, riders see long waits clustered in one zone. Please don't tune the weights live — page the routing lead first. The override procedure and known failure modes are documented on the internal runbook page.

dashboard of bafof-hafog = https://confluence.lumiclabs.internal/display/browse/display/6a09a20a